Trade show and event freight is its own world. Advance warehouse deadlines, targeted move in dates, marshalling yards, drayage, and move out paperwork that has to be right the first time or it costs the exhibitor real money. What you will own
The trade show calendar. Maintain a full calendar of every show, convention, and event where we have moved freight using our proprietary trade show freight management software. Know when the shipping windows open and close, and make sure sales and operations hear about them well before the deadline, not after.
Show attendance. Travel to select shows to work the floor in person. Handle material handling agreements, oversee our exhibitors' move in and move out, and keep freight moving through the dock on schedule. Meet decorators and show management face to face while you are there.
Repeat business. Watch our inbound and outbound exhibitor shipments for repeat opportunities. Spot the clients who shipped last year but have not booked yet, and get sales on them before the window closes. Losing repeat show freight because nobody flagged the date is the exact thing this role exists to prevent.
Decorator and venue relationships. Build and maintain working relationships with the major general service contractors, Freeman, GES, T3 Expo, and the independents. Get to know the show coordinators and floor managers at the convention centers we work. The goal is smoother move in and move out for our exhibitors, better dock access, and real visibility into scheduling.
Carrier development. Work with our carrier sales team to build a reliable network of long haul and final mile carriers who actually know trade show and event freight, marshalling yards, targeted move outs, and time sensitive show deadlines. A carrier who has never worked a show floor is a problem waiting to happen, and part of your job is knowing the difference.
Operational execution. Partner with operations to make sure show shipments are scheduled, tracked, and executed clean. When something goes sideways during a move in or move out, you are the person who knows how to troubleshoot it fast.
Reporting. Track trade show revenue and gross margin against our goals and keep leadership updated on progress. Surface the trends, the opportunities, and the operational fixes worth making.
Process and tools. Help build standardized workflows for quoting, booking, documentation, and tracking show freight. Push for the technology and process improvements that give clients and our internal team better visibility.
Client support. Be the internal expert sales leans on for trade show exhibitors. Help with the tricky quotes, the complex logistics planning, and the scheduling that makes or breaks a client's event.
